Abstract

A collection of documents or other files and the like within an enterprise network are labelled according to an enterprise document classification scheme, and then a recognition model such as a neural network or other machine learning model can be used to automatically label other files throughout the enterprise network. In this manner, documents and the like throughout an enterprise can be automatically identified and managed according to features such as confidentiality, sensitivity, security risk, business value, and so forth.

Claims (38)

1. A computer program product comprising computer executable code embodied in a non-transitory computer readable medium that, when executing on one or more computing devices, performs the steps of:

selecting a plurality of documents stored in an enterprise network;

automatically labeling each of the plurality of documents with a category for sensitivity according to an organization role associated with a file location of the document in the enterprise network, an organization role of a user in an access control list associated with the document, and content of each of the plurality of documents, thereby providing a labeled data set;

configuring a recognition model to identify the category for sensitivity for a new document based on the plurality of documents in the labeled data set;

locating other documents in the enterprise network different than the plurality of documents;

associating a label with each of the other documents based upon the category for sensitivity identified by the recognition model for each of the other documents; and

applying an enterprise policy for sensitivity to each of the other documents based upon the category for sensitivity identified in the label, wherein the enterprise policy controls at least one of document access and document movement.

2. A method comprising:

selecting a plurality of files stored in an enterprise network;

labeling each of the plurality of files according to a category selected from two or more predetermined categories, thereby providing a labeled data set, each of the two or more predetermined categories identify at least one of: an organizational role associated with a folder where a corresponding one of the plurality of files is located, a corresponding organizational role of one or more users associated with each of the plurality of files, a list of permissions for use of the corresponding one of the plurality of files, and content of the corresponding one file of the plurality of files;

configuring a recognition model to identify the category from one of the two or more predetermined categories for a new file based on the plurality of files in the labeled data set;

locating other files in the enterprise network different than the plurality of files;

associating a label with each of the other files based upon the category selected for each of the other files from the two or more predetermined categories by the recognition model; and

applying an enterprise policy to each of the other files based upon the category identified in the label.
